Graham Higman
Graham Higman FRS (19 January 1917 – 8 April 2008) was a prominent British mathematician known for his contributions to group theory.

Walter Feit
Walter Feit (October 26, 1930 – July 29, 2004) was an American mathematician who worked in finite group theory and representation theory.
